Lemma 37.30.6. Let $f : X \to Y$ be a proper, flat morphism of schemes of finite presentation. Let $n_{X/Y}$ be the function on $Y$ giving the dimension of fibres of $f$ introduced in Lemma 37.30.2. Then $n_{X/Y}$ is locally constant.
Proof. Immediate consequence of Lemmas 37.30.4 and 37.30.5. $\square$
